As a Production Supervisor, you will be responsible for leading a team of non-exempt employees in CVS Health’s distribution facility. Direct workflow for warehouse employees and lead their team to meet and exceed daily targets. Manages day to day work operations and evaluates work performance. Assists manager in the total leadership and operations with initiative, leadership, and continuous improvement thinking Shift Monday-Friday 5AM to 3PM with occasional weekends and additional flexibility as needed to support the needs of the business. Selected candidate will need to have flexibility of working hours, during initial training period.

Requirements

  • Minimum 3 years supervising Production Control functions within a Distribution Center/Warehouse
  • Minimum 2 years supervisory experience
  • 1 year of experience with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
  • Bi-Lingual

Nice To Haves

  • Knowledge of WMS (Warehouse Management System)
  • Bachelor's Degree
  • Background in Six Sigma production techniques.

Responsibilities

  • Hiring, on-boarding, training, scheduling, and assigning work to all colleagues reporting to this role
  • Maintain a high level of performance for Production area. Ensure all orders are picked and packed in a timely fashion as per CVS standards, policy and cycle time.
  • Manage and sustain a high level of standards through 5S, lean and cleanliness across the DC using CVS SOP and protocols
  • Ensure that all hourly colleagues are trained on PIT equipment as per policy and their licenses are up to date at all times as per OSHA regulations
  • Promotes, reinforces, and holds all colleagues accountable for safety, security, awareness and compliance
  • Executes daily activities and operational plans in compliance with all SOP’s, Processes and strategies to enhance the culture of excellence and innovation across the enterprise while meeting daily targets.
  • Strive to meet or exceed all Key performance Indicators in our supply chain pillars of Safety, Quality, Delivery, Cost, Production and People
  • Conducts performance appraisals, Training and PUMPS using various reports, summaries, and procedures as necessary to resolve problems and improve employee performance efficiency
  • Coordinates processes and assignments with leadership of all DC areas within the warehouse to achieve a balanced workload and meet daily operational metrics. Adapt quickly to operational needs and urgencies to make decisions and execute them to meet goals.
  • Defines terms for conducting tasks and establishes new priorities for assignments to meet operational success.
  • Manage team performance through timely feedback and performance review process to ensure delivery of engagement, motivation, and team development.
